Для обработки ошибок при загрузке изображений в React Native можно использовать свойство onError компонента Image. 13 Оно возвращает событие ошибки изображения, когда загрузка по заданному удалённому URL не проходит. 3
Некоторые рекомендации по обработке ошибок:
- Использовать изображение-заполнитель. 1 Его можно отображать во время загрузки реального изображения. 1 Это поможет определить, в чём проблема: в загрузке изображения или в отображении компонента. 1
- Оптимизировать размер изображений. 1 Большие изображения могут замедлять работу приложения. 1 Для сжатия изображений без потери качества можно использовать, например, инструменты ImageOptim или TinyPNG. 1
- Проверять URL изображения. 1 Можно использовать веб-браузер, чтобы убедиться, что URL правильный и изображение загружается успешно. 1
- Убедиться, что формат изображения поддерживается React Native. 1 React Native поддерживает различные форматы изображений, но не все. 1
Также для обработки ошибок при загрузке изображений в React Native можно использовать другие методы, например, prefetch() — предварительную выборку удалённого изображения для последующего использования путём загрузки его в дисковый кэш. 5